Split切分字串
尚硅谷Golang課

Split切分字串

// abc,b=>[a c]
func Split(str, sep string) []string {
	// str="bsfcvjkhbafs" sep="b"
	var ret = make([]string, 0, strings.Count(str, sep)+1)
	index := strings.Index(str, sep)
	for index >= 0 {
		ret = append(ret, str[:index])
		str = str[index+len(sep):]
		index = strings.Index(str, sep)
	}
	ret = append(ret, str)
	return ret
}

上次修改於 2021-08-01

此篇文章的評論功能已經停用。